Sellwin Traders Limited has announced the resignation of its statutory auditor M/s. J. Singh & Associates, effective January 15, 2026. The company filed the necessary regulatory disclosure with BSE Limited under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.
Auditor Details and Tenure
The resignation involves Hemant Kumar Shantilal Mehta, Partner at J. Singh & Associates (FRN: 110266W), who served as the statutory auditor for the company. The auditing firm was originally appointed on September 1, 2023, with a term scheduled to expire on September 30, 2028.

Reasons for Resignation
The auditing firm cited two primary reasons for their resignation:
- Partner Resignation: A key partner who was primarily responsible for overseeing audits of Sellwin Traders Limited recently resigned from the partnership, resulting in a significant reduction in audit leadership capacity
- Staff Constraints: The firm is experiencing acute staff shortages and resource limitations, making it unable to allocate necessary team strength for timely and quality audit completion
Regulatory Compliance
J. Singh & Associates confirmed that there are no other material reasons for the resignation beyond those stated. The firm provided all required information and explanations under Section 140(2) of the Companies Act, 2013, read with Rule 8 of the Companies (Audit and Auditors) Rules, 2014.
The auditor also confirmed that no concerns were raised with the Audit Committee or Board of Directors prior to the resignation, and there were no instances where requested information was not provided by the company management.
Company Response
Sellwin Traders Limited, through Company Secretary & Compliance Officer Pratiti Patel, filed the resignation letter along with Annexure A as per the circular issued by the Securities Exchange Board of India (CIR/CFD/CMD1/114/2019) dated October 18, 2019. The company will need to appoint a new statutory auditor to complete the remaining audit work within regulatory timelines.
